New Mexico State University Us, New Mexico State University (NMSU) is a public research university located in Las Cruces, New Mexico, United States. It is the oldest public institution of higher education in the state and is a flagship university in the New Mexico State University System. Here are some key details about NMSU:
- History: NMSU was established in 1888 as Las Cruces College and later renamed New Mexico College of Agriculture and Mechanic Arts. In 1960, it became New Mexico State University.
- Campus: The main campus of NMSU covers over 900 acres and is located in Las Cruces, which is in the southern part of New Mexico. The university also has several branch campuses throughout the state, including Alamogordo, Carlsbad, Doña Ana, and Grants.
- Academic Programs: NMSU offers a wide range of academic programs, including undergraduate, graduate, and professional degrees. It has colleges and schools dedicated to fields such as agriculture, arts and sciences, business, education, engineering, health and social services, and more.
- Research and Facilities: NMSU is known for its research endeavors in areas such as agriculture, engineering, space science, and water resources. It houses various research centers and institutes, including the Physical Science Laboratory and the Chile Pepper Institute.
- Student Life: NMSU has a diverse student body, with students from all 50 states and over 70 countries. The university offers a range of extracurricular activities, including student organizations, clubs, sports teams, and cultural events. The Aggies are the athletic teams representing NMSU, competing in NCAA Division I.
- Community Engagement: NMSU is deeply connected to its surrounding community and collaborates with local businesses, government agencies, and organizations. It plays a significant role in supporting economic development, agricultural research, and community outreach programs.
- Notable Alumni: NMSU has produced numerous notable alumni, including former NASA astronaut Harrison Schmitt, journalist Sam Donaldson, and former Secretary of Agriculture Tom Vilsack.

eligibility of New Mexico State University Us
The eligibility requirements for New Mexico State University (NMSU) may vary depending on the level of study (undergraduate, graduate) and the specific program you are applying to. Here is a general overview of the eligibility criteria:
Undergraduate Admissions:
- High School Diploma or Equivalent: Applicants should have completed a high school education or have an equivalent qualification.
- Minimum GPA: NMSU typically requires a minimum grade point average (GPA) for undergraduate admissions. The specific GPA requirement may vary by program.
- Standardized Test Scores: Some undergraduate programs may require standardized test scores, such as the SAT or ACT. Check the program requirements for specific score requirements.
- English Language Proficiency: International applicants whose native language is not English may need to demonstrate English language proficiency through tests like the TOEFL or IELTS.
Graduate Admissions:
- Bachelor’s Degree: Applicants must hold a bachelor’s degree or its equivalent from an accredited institution.
- Minimum GPA: Most graduate programs at NMSU require a minimum GPA, typically around 3.0 or higher. Some programs may have higher GPA requirements.
- Standardized Test Scores: Many graduate programs require standardized test scores, such as the GRE or GMAT. However, some programs may waive the requirement or have specific requirements based on the field of study.
- Letters of Recommendation: Graduate programs often require letters of recommendation from professors or professionals who can attest to the applicant’s academic abilities and potential.
- Statement of Purpose or Personal Statement: Many graduate programs ask for a statement of purpose or personal statement that outlines the applicant’s academic and career goals, as well as their motivation for pursuing the program.
